LOUISVILLE, Ky. –
The University of Louisville will play host to the 2012 Pre-National Invitational on Oct. 13, with the race being held at E.P. ‘Tom’ Sawyer State Park in Louisville.
The event serves as a pre-cursor for the national championships, as Louisville and the city of Louisville will be first time hosts of the NCAA Division I Championships this
fall.
The Pre-Nationals Intent to Compete form is available at http://www.uoflsports.com/sports/m-xc/spec-rel/pre-national-form.html.
For the first time since World War II, the NCAA Division I Cross Country Championships will be held on a Saturday, taking place at E.P. ‘Tom' Sawyer State Park on Nov. 17.
The city previously played host to the 2010 NCAA Division II Cross Country Championships, five NAIA National Championships, two BIG EAST Conference Championships, five NCAA
Division I Southeast Regional Championships and the 2010 NCAA Division II National Championships.
